Meet Carey Rohrbeck
Carey grew up in Lake Charles and graduated from Barbe High School before attending McNeese State University. She moved away for a few years, but her love for the Lake Area eventually brought her home.
Carey chose to join the Acadian Hearing team because of the people who work here. She has been consistently impressed by everyone's integrity and kindness.
A typical workday for Carey involves conducting hearing evaluations, fitting and programming hearing instruments, and guiding patients through the process of better hearing. She spends her day performing follow-up adjustments, counseling patients on how to get the most from their devices, and ensuring each visit leaves patients feeling confident and well cared for.
Her favorite part of the role is getting the chance to meet someone new every day. She genuinely enjoys learning how our team can personalize care to best meet each patient's needs.
In her free time, Carey enjoys Bible studies, shopping, traveling, and spending time with her family and friends.
